We have been with Airvoice Wireless since PTel suddenly went under, and have been very happy.
My wife is on the $20 unlimited talk/text and a smidge of data plan; I'm on the pay as you go $10/month plan paired with a lot of Google Voice texting (free) and Google Hangout calls (free). I basically never use the $10 I pay each month, and build a balance that I'll occasionally burn through when I'm out and about and turn on data for whatever.
Anyway, would definitely recommend for someone coming from AT&T, especially if you want to stay on the network.
